What is the Special Valuation Branch (SVB)?
The Special Valuation Branch (SVB) is a specialised Indian Customs unit that reviews import transactions where the Indian importer and overseas supplier are related parties. It verifies whether the declared import value is genuine and not influenced by the relationship. The SVB examines documents such as the Annexure-A questionnaire, pricing records, and financial data before issuing an SVB Order accepting or revising the transaction value.
During the investigation, imports are usually cleared under provisional assessment, and an Extra Duty Deposit (EDD) may be required until the SVB order is issued.

Our Process
A clear step-by-step approach from initial enquiry to final delivery.
Relationship Assessment
We review the nature and documentation of your related party relationship — shareholding, directorship, agreement terms, and pricing methodology.
Questionnaire Filing
Comprehensive Annexure-A questionnaire is prepared and filed at the SVB office at the port of first import. This is the most critical step.
Provisional Assessment Period
During the SVB investigation, all imports proceed on provisional assessment. EDD is deposited on each Bill of Entry. We track all EDDs.
Investigation Response
SVB may send additional queries or call for hearings. We prepare responses, draft submissions, and if needed, attend SVB hearings.
SVB Order
SVB issues its Order determining whether the declared transaction value is acceptable. We review the order and assess implications.
Renewal and Compliance
The SVB Order is valid for 3 years. We monitor compliance and initiate renewal applications 60 days before expiry.

SVB Process Complexity
The SVB Annexure-A questionnaire is highly detailed and technical. Incorrect or incomplete responses lead to enhanced duty demands and protracted investigations.
TP Coordination
SVB valuation and transfer pricing (CBDT) often cover the same related-party transactions. We coordinate with your TP consultant to ensure consistency.
EDD Recovery
Significant EDD amounts accumulate over the 3-12 month investigation period. We track all EDDs and file refund applications promptly after a favourable SVB Order.
